Hermes Agent s'installe avec une seule commande et fonctionne sur Linux, macOS ou WSL2. Mais l'installation est la partie facile — la différence entre « il fonctionne » et « il s'améliore vraiment avec le temps » réside dans la configuration. La plupart des utilisateurs qui trouvent Hermes décevant n'ont jamais activé les fonctionnalités qui le rendent unique.
Ce guide couvre tout, de la première installation à votre première tâche automatisée, avec les étapes de configuration que la plupart des tutoriels sautent.
Point clé
L'installation prend 2 minutes. La configuration prend 15. Les étapes critiques que la plupart des gens manquent : activer persistent_memory et skill_generation dans la config. Sans cela, Hermes se comporte comme n'importe quel autre agent mono-session.
Que faut-il avant d'installer ?
Presque rien. L'installateur de Hermes gère automatiquement les dépendances. Vous avez besoin de :
| Exigence | Détails |
|---|---|
| Système d'exploitation | Linux, macOS, ou Windows avec WSL2 |
| Clé LLM API | Au moins une : Anthropic (Claude), OpenAI (GPT), Google (Gemini), ou OpenRouter |
| Matériel | Toute machine moderne. Pour un fonctionnement continu : VPS à 5-10 $/mois convient parfaitement |
| Accès terminal | Connaissances de base en ligne de commande |
Comment installer Hermes Agent ?
Étape 1 : Lancez l'installateur.
Cela télécharge et configure tout — Node.js, dépendances Python, SQLite et l'environnement d'exécution Hermes. Prend 1-3 minutes selon votre connexion.
Étape 2 : Configurez votre fournisseur LLM.
Après l'installation, Hermes vous demande quel fournisseur LLM utiliser. Les options les plus courantes :
📋 EXEMPLES DE CONFIG FOURNISSEUR
# Pour Claude (meilleure qualité, coût plus élevé) provider: anthropic model: claude-sonnet-4-20250514 api_key: sk-ant-... # Pour GPT (bon équilibre) provider: openai model: gpt-5.4 api_key: sk-... # Pour configurations économiques (gratuit via OpenRouter) provider: openrouter model: qwen/qwen-3.5 api_key: sk-or-...
Consensus de la communauté sur les modèles : GPT 5.4 avec mode réflexion sur medium+ est le plus populaire au quotidien. Qwen 3.5 sur OpenRouter est gratuit et suffisant pour l'automatisation courante. Claude Opus produit la meilleure qualité mais coûte beaucoup plus cher — et Anthropic restreint les usages intensifs tiers.
Étape 3 : Activez les fonctionnalités qui comptent.
C'est là que la plupart des tutoriels vous lâchent. Ouvrez votre fichier de config Hermes et activez ces deux paramètres :
Sans cela, Hermes oublie tout entre les sessions et ne crée jamais de compétences réutilisables. Il devient juste un autre wrapper de chatbot. Avec ces options activées, chaque tâche complexe (5+ appels d'outils) crée automatiquement un fichier de compétence, et toutes les conversations sont recherchables entre sessions.
---📬 Vous en tirez de la valeur ? Nous publions des guides hebdomadaires sur les outils et workflows IA. Recevez-les dans votre boîte →
---Comment lancer votre première tâche ?
Démarrez Hermes dans votre terminal :
Vous êtes maintenant en session interactive. Testez ces tâches de démarrage pour vérifier que tout fonctionne :
Test conversation basique : « De quoi peux-tu m'aider ? » — vérifie que la connexion LLM fonctionne.
Test recherche web : « Recherche les dernières nouvelles sur Nous Research et résume-les en 3 points. » — vérifie que les appels d'outils fonctionnent.
Test création de compétence : « Recherche les 5 meilleurs frameworks d'agents IA en 2026, compare leurs fonctionnalités et rédige un rapport de synthèse. » — cela devrait déclencher 5+ appels d'outils, ce qui signifie que Hermes créera automatiquement un fichier de compétence à la fin. Vérifiez votre répertoire de compétences pour confirmer la création du fichier.
Test mémoire : Fermez la session, relancez-en une nouvelle et demandez « De quoi avons-nous parlé la dernière fois ? ». Si la mémoire persistante fonctionne, Hermes se souviendra de la conversation précédente.
Comment connecter des plateformes de messagerie ?
Hermes supporte Discord, Telegram, Slack, Microsoft Teams et plus. Chaque plateforme nécessite de créer un token de bot et de l'ajouter à la config. Voici Discord en exemple :
1. Créez un bot Discord sur discord.com/developers/applications
2. Copiez le token du bot
3. Ajoutez à votre config Hermes :
4. Redémarrez Hermes. Votre bot apparaît dans votre serveur Discord, prêt à répondre.
Le même schéma s'applique à Telegram (token BotFather), Slack (token OAuth app) et autres plateformes. Hermes v0.10.0 a ajouté Microsoft Teams comme plateforme fournie en plugin et supporte au total plus de 18 plateformes de messagerie.
Comment configurer des profils pour plusieurs cas d'usage ?
Hermes v0.6.0 a introduit les profils — instances isolées avec configuration, mémoire, compétences et connexions gateway séparées. Cela vous permet d'exécuter un profil « travail » avec intégration Slack et un profil « personnel » avec Telegram, chacun avec sa propre mémoire et compétences apprises.
Quelles sont les erreurs de configuration les plus courantes ?
| Erreur | Symptôme | Solution |
|---|---|---|
| persistent_memory non activé | L'agent oublie tout entre les sessions | Définir persistent_memory: true dans la config |
| skill_generation non activé | Aucun fichier de compétence créé après tâches complexes | Définir skill_generation: true dans la config |
| Utilisation de paramètres de modèle à faible effort | La qualité de sortie semble dégradée | Définir effort sur high ou xhigh |
| Exécution sur VPS public sans durcissement | Exposition à la sécurité | Activer l'isolation conteneur, root en lecture seule |
| Pas de configuration checkpoint/rollback | Impossible de récupérer des erreurs d'agent | Activer les checkpoints système de fichiers dans la config |
Pour une meilleure compréhension de fonctionnement des agents IA et de la place de Hermes dans l'écosystème, consultez notre guide complet. Et pour de meilleurs prompts lors d'interactions avec n'importe quel agent IA, essayez le Prompt Optimizer gratuit.
---📬 Vous en voulez plus ? Guides pratiques de configuration IA, hebdomadaires. Abonnez-vous gratuitement →
---Questions fréquemment posées
Combien de temps prend la configuration ?
L'installation prend 2 minutes. La configuration LLM de base prend 5 minutes. Activer mémoire, compétences et intégrations messagerie prend 10-15 minutes supplémentaires. Total : moins de 30 minutes pour un agent pleinement fonctionnel.
Puis-je exécuter Hermes Agent sur un Raspberry Pi ?
Techniquement oui (fonctionne sur Linux), mais les performances seront limitées. Un VPS à 5-10 $/mois chez DigitalOcean ou Hetzner offre de meilleures performances et un fonctionnement continu.
Que se passe-t-il si je change de fournisseur LLM plus tard ?
Le changement se fait via la config — aucune modification de code requise. Votre mémoire, compétences et historique de conversations sont préservés. Seules les réponses LLM changeront en qualité/style selon le nouveau modèle.
Ai-je besoin de Docker ?
Non. L'installation standard ne requiert pas Docker. Docker est optionnel et recommandé uniquement pour les déploiements en production où vous voulez une isolation conteneur pour la sécurité.
Déclaration : Certains liens dans cet article sont des liens affiliés. Nous ne recommandons que des outils que nous avons testés personnellement et utilisons régulièrement. Voir notre politique de divulgation complète.